Beef, Bacon and Noodle Bake
0 Likes
Prep Time:
15 minutes
Total Time:
2 hours 25 minutes
Effortlessly combine beef, bacon, and veggies in a quick casserole with uncooked noodles.
Ingredients:
  • 4 slices bacon, cut into 3/4-inch pieces
  • 1 1/2 lb beef stew meat
  • 1/2 teaspoon peppered seasoned salt
  • 1 medium onion, chopped (1/2 cup)
  • 1 1/2 cups baby-cut carrots
  • 1 can (14.5 oz) diced tomatoes with basil, garlic and oregano, undrained
  • 1 jar (12 oz) beef gravy
  • 1 cup water
  • 2 cups uncooked wide egg noodles (4 oz)
  • 1 1/2 cups frozen whole green beans (from 14-oz bag)
Instructions:
  • Preheat oven to 325°F and generously coat a 13x9-inch (3-quart) glass baking dish with cooking spray.
  • In a 12-inch nonstick skillet, sizzle bacon over medium-high heat for 3 minutes, stirring occasionally. Add beef, seasoned salt, and onion. Cook, stirring occasionally, until beef is nicely browned.
  • Transfer the flavorful beef mixture to a baking dish. Gently combine with carrots, tomatoes, gravy, and water. Cover with foil and bake for 1 hour and 30 minutes until tender.
  • Combine the noodles and green beans into the mixture. Cover and bake for 20 to 25 minutes, or until the beef, noodles, and beans are tender.
